Compatible with both handheld and vehicle-mounted power supplies. This system is designed with practical application in mind, supporting flexible power solutions: it can be connected to a lightweight handheld battery pack for mobile deployment by a single soldier; or it can be directly connected in parallel to a high-power vehicle-mounted power supply to meet the needs of police cars and command vehicles for long-term patrols and high-speed tracking missions. The power management module features automatic switching and overload protection to ensure that detection and countermeasure capabilities are not affected during switching.

The system employs high-performance signal processing and a dedicated FPGA/ASIC accelerator to achieve millisecond-level target detection and identification. Combined with preset countermeasure strategies, operators can complete locking, tracking, and command output within seconds through a one-click rapid deployment interface, greatly shortening the time window from detection to response, making it suitable for emergency response to sudden airspace intrusions.
To ensure long-term continuous operation, the equipment employs a composite heat dissipation design combining active air cooling and heat pipes, and incorporates temperature sensors and intelligent adjustment algorithms in key modules. Under high load or high temperature environments, it automatically reduces frequency and optimizes task priorities, extending continuous operation capability while preventing performance degradation or malfunctions caused by overheating.
